ROASTED SMASHED POTATOES
The key to perfect smashed potatoes is completely chilling the parboiled potatoes before smashing, which gives you plenty of time to infuse some butter with garlic and herbs for drizzling over top. Roasted, the potatoes will end up crispy, buttery, and crusty on the outside, with a light, fluffy interior. It's like taking the best parts of home fries, mashed potatoes, French fries, and potato pancakes, and smashing them all together.

Steps:
- Place potatoes into a 5-quart stockpot and cover with 3 quarts of cold water. Add kosher salt and bring to a simmer over high heat. Reduce heat to medium-low and simmer gently until potatoes are just tender, 15 to 20 minutes. Remove from heat and drain well. Let potatoes cool just until they're safe to handle.
- Transfer potatoes onto a sheet pan and continue cooling to room temperature. Make 4 or 5 shallow cuts down the sides of each potato, about every inch or so, to ensure the skin splits evenly when smashed. Refrigerate until completely chilled and ready to smash; 8 hours to overnight is best.
- Combine butter, sliced garlic, rosemary, and thyme in a small pan over medium heat. Cook, stirring occasionally, until butter melts and begins to bubble, and garlic softens and starts to turn translucent, 3 to 5 minutes. Remove from heat.
- Preheat the oven to 450 degrees F (232 degrees C). Line 2 metal baking sheets with silicone baking mats (such as Silpat®) and generously brush on some of the infused melted butter.
- Remove potatoes from the fridge and gently smash each between two pieces of plastic using a flat, heavy object until 1/2- to 3/4-inch thick. Season generously with salt, pepper, and cayenne on both sides, being careful not to break potatoes up into small pieces. Transfer onto a sheet pan, being careful not to overlap potatoes. Very generously drizzle and brush most of the melted butter on top.
- Bake potatoes in the preheated oven until well browned and crunchy around the edges, 35 to 45 minutes.
- Meanwhile, place the pan with the remaining garlic and herb butter back over medium-low heat. Cook, stirring, until garlic starts to turn a very light golden brown, 3 to 4 minutes. Remove from heat and reserve.
- Carefully transfer potatoes onto a serving platter and scatter over the golden brown slices of garlic. Crumble the toasted herbs on top if desired. Serve immediately.

GARLIC SMASHED POTATOES
This double-cooking technique (boiling, then roasting) works very well with whole red potatoes. The finished potatoes are rough and crisp and very good.

Steps:
- In a large soup pot combine the potatoes and garlic with enough water to cover them by several inches.
- Bring the water to a boil, cover the pan, and lower the heat.
- Let the pototoes simmer steadily for 20 minutes or until they are tender when pierced with a skewer.
- Set the oven at 450 degrees.
- Have on hand a 12-inch baking dish.
- Rub the dish with a thin film of oil.
- Drain the potatoes and garlic and set them aside until they are cool enough to handle- do not let the potatoes become cold.
- Cut the potatoes into quarters and squeeze each one with your fingers or set the potatoes on a board and tap them lightly with a mallet.
- Transfer the potatoes to the baking dish, packing them tightly into the dish.
- Chop the garlic and scatter it on the potatoes.
- Drizzle the oil on top of the potatoes and sprinkle them with salt and pepper.
- Transfer the dish to the hot oven.
- Roast the potatoes for 20 minutes or until the top is crusty and golden brown.
- Serve at once.
